Output dc62a61064773975a597eb31bb827e53877fdc56837d788c36d24f1f9fe37cbf:4

value
12128818
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f74abcdcded957582f962c44b8e6a2d7e034287 OP_EQUAL
address
3LbwZhkaJDUe7vD7sZ8US29eBP5YAyumPi
transaction
dc62a61064773975a597eb31bb827e53877fdc56837d788c36d24f1f9fe37cbf
confirmations
485884
spent
true